I like the 16X20 size for my studio walls because I can take them with me when I set up my outdoor booth. Larger prints would be too big for the tent. But, my studio is fairly compact so 16X20 works there. If you have more room, larger prints would be really nice. I mount mine on styrene and they stay pretty stable indoors or out.

I'm thinking of doing a bunch as gallery wraps on canvass for several of the Arts & Crafts shows in the area. Those will be as big as I can afford. If I like them, I may integrate them into my studio display as well. As Julie says, once folks see the big prints they really want them.
